Exigences INF du pilote Miniport MB
Les pilotes miniport MB doivent avoir les entrées suivantes dans leur fichier INF :
*IfType = 243; IF_TYPE_WWANPP
*MediaType = 9; <mark type="enumval">NdisMediumWirelessWan</mark>
*PhysicalMediaType = 8; NdisPhysicalMediumWirelessWan
EnableDhcp = 0; Disable DHCP
;Entries to be put in add-registry-section for NdisMediumWirelessWan
HKR, Ndi\Interfaces, UpperRange, 0, "flpp4, flpp6"
HKR, Ndi\Interfaces, LowerRange, 0, "ppip"
Toutes les entrées mentionnées dans l’exemple de code précédent, à l’exception de UpperRange et LowerRange, doivent se trouver dans la même section INF que celle des mots clés tels que AddReg et CopyFiles. UpperRange et LowerRange doivent être placés dans la section add-registry du fichier INF.
*IfType
Les appareils en mode double peuvent spécifier l’une des valeurs IfType du tableau suivant :
Description |
Nom |
IfType |
Appareils Mb basés sur GSM |
IF_TYPE_WWANPP |
243 |
Appareils Mo basés sur CDMA |
IF_TYPE_WWANPP2 |
244 |
*MediaType
Les pilotes miniport mo doivent spécifier l’une des valeurs MediaType du tableau suivant en fonction du type de paquet encadrant le pilote miniport capable d’interpréter dans son chemin d’envoi et de réception des données.
Description |
Nom |
MediaType |
Les pilotes miniport mo qui interprètent les paquets 802.3 doivent signaler ce type de média. Ce framework est uniquement destiné à la migration d’anciens pilotes miniport et n’est pas recommandé pour les pilotes miniport de qualité de production. |
NdisMedium802_3 |
0 |
Les pilotes miniport mo capables de gérer le trafic IP brut doivent définir ce type de média. Il s’agit du type de média recommandé à utiliser dans les pilotes miniport de qualité de production. |
NdisMediumWirelessWan |
9 |
EnableDhcp
Les pilotes de miniport mo doivent spécifier l’une des valeurs EnableDhcp du tableau suivant, selon qu’ils implémentent ou non l’émulation de serveur DHCP.
Valeur |
Description |
0 |
Désactivez DHCP pour cette interface. Le pilote miniport n’implémente pas l’usurpation de serveur DHCP. Il s’agit de la valeur recommandée à utiliser dans les pilotes de qualité de production. |
1 |
Activez DHCP pour cette interface. Le pilote miniport implémente l’usurpation de serveur DHCP. Autrement dit, le pilote miniport doit usurper un serveur DHCP et des résolutions ARP. |
UpperRange
Cette mot clé est définie avec une ou plusieurs combinaisons des chaînes suivantes, le cas échéant, lorsque le type de média est NdisMediumWirelessWan. NdisMedium802_3 pilotes miniport doivent utiliser les valeurs existantes dans UpperRange.
Valeur |
Description |
« flpp4 » |
Les pilotes miniport spécifient « flpp4 » si le périphérique Mo prend en charge IPv4. |
« flpp6 » |
Les pilotes Miniport spécifient « flpp6 » si le périphérique Mo prend en charge IPv6. Cette valeur est nécessaire uniquement pour les appareils qui prennent en charge IPv6. |
LowerRange
Cette mot clé doit avoir, au minimum, la valeur suivante lorsque le type de média est NdisMediumWirelessWan. NdisMedium802_3 pilotes miniport doivent utiliser les valeurs existantes dans LowerRange.
Valeur |
Description |
« ppip » |
Type d’appareil Mo sur le bord inférieur. |